Listen "#87 - Sleep Masks: I'll Wear a Mask for You"
Episode Synopsis
A simple piece of cloth over the eyes can have a powerful effect of the quality on an individual's sleep. The evolution of the sleep mask has been profound and the available literature of their effectiveness, particularly in the hospital setting has be extensively studied.
